Maintaining and Replacing Coil Springs on Your 1993 Nissan Primera
It's essential to stay attentive to the suspension components on your 1993 Nissan Primera, particularly the coil springs, to ensure a smooth and safe driving experience. Coil springs are pivotal for maintaining the ride height and handling characteristics of your vehicle. They work in conjunction with the shock absorbers to support your car's weight, absorb road shocks, and provide a stable ride. If you're considering maintaining or replacing the coil springs, here's some guidance to keep your Primera in top condition.
First off, regular inspections are key to ensuring the longevity and performance of your coil springs. Look for any signs of wear and tear, such as rust, cracks, or sagging. If the springs look compromised, it's time to consider a replacement. Driving on weakened coil springs can lead to further suspension damage and negatively impact handling.
Here are some handy tips for coil spring replacement:
- Review the Vehicle Owner's Manual: Before diving into any maintenance work, consult your Primera's owner's manual for specific guidelines related to the suspension system. This ensures that you're aware of the correct specifications and procedures.
- Choose Quality Springs: When replacing coil springs, it's crucial to select high-quality components that match your original specifications. This might mean consulting with a parts specialist to ensure compatibility and performance.
- Jack Up Your Vehicle Safely: Securely lift your car using a hydraulic jack and provide additional support with jack stands. This ensures you can work safely under the vehicle. Be cautious to avoid working under a car supported only by a jack.
- Remove Relevant Components: To access the coil springs, you'll need to disassemble parts of the suspension assembly. This generally involves removing the wheels, and possibly the struts or shock absorbers, to gain clear access to the springs.
- Install New Springs with Care: Carefully remove the worn springs and replace them with the new ones. Ensure they align properly in their seats to avoid noise and handling problems. In some cases, it might be beneficial to replace shock absorbers or struts simultaneously for balanced performance.
- Reassemble and Test Drive: Once the new springs are installed, reassemble the components and lower your vehicle. Take your Primera for a test drive on different road conditions to ensure the ride quality and handling are up to par.
Regularly maintaining the coil springs is a sure way to enhance the driving experience and prolong the longevity of your Nissan Primera. With proper maintenance and timely replacements, you can enjoy smooth rides and stable handling while safeguarding your vehicle from potential suspension issues.
